Using the transformation T : (x, y) → (x + 2, y + 1), find the distance named Find C'A'

we have that
A' (2,1)

C(-2,2)-------> 
Using the transformation-----> C' (-2+2,2+1)----> C' (0,3)

with 
A' (2,1) and C' (0,3)
find the distance C'A'

d=
√[(y2-y1)²+(x2-x1)²]----> d=√[(3-1)²+(0-2)²]----> d=√8----> 2√2 units

the answer is
the distance C'A' is 2√2 units
